Step 2: Learn Agile and Scrum for Modern Project Delivery
Today’s organizations expect teams to deliver software quickly while adapting to changing customer requirements. Agile methodologies have replaced traditional project execution in many industries.
Scrum introduces structured collaboration through defined roles, sprint planning, daily stand-up meetings, and continuous feedback. These practices improve productivity and product quality while encouraging teamwork.
Agile knowledge is valuable not only for project managers but also for developers, testers, business analysts, and product owners.

Step 4: Understand ITIL for Better IT Service Management
Technology teams don’t simply build software—they also maintain services that customers rely on every day.
ITIL provides internationally accepted best practices for delivering reliable IT services. It focuses on service strategy, incident management, problem management, change management, and continual service improvement.
Organizations implementing ITIL frameworks improve operational efficiency while maintaining higher service quality and customer satisfaction.
Step 5: Add DevOps Skills to Accelerate Software Delivery
DevOps connects software development and IT operations by encouraging automation, collaboration, and continuous delivery.
Instead of manual deployments and lengthy release cycles, DevOps enables organizations to release software more frequently with greater reliability.
Key DevOps skills include:
- Continuous Integration (CI)
- Continuous Deployment (CD)
- Infrastructure as Code
- Containerization
- Monitoring and logging
- Automation tools
Cloud platforms such as AWS provide the infrastructure required for successful DevOps implementation, making cloud knowledge an important advantage.
